Wallpaper: “End of the Dock”

I released a new wallpapers today, along with a matching logon for Windows Vista. The wallpaper pack has a wide variety of screen resolutions including widescreen. WindowBlinds 6.1 Update

There is a free update for existing users of WindowBlinds available. The most notable feature is the addition of the Explorer Background feature which allows you to apply a background, and adjust the opacity of the Explorer background.
